Biography: The Man Behind the Characters

Tom Selleck, the actor many people think of when they hear "Selleck," has had a truly distinguished career, stretching over many decades. He's an American actor, and also a television and film producer and screenwriter, which is pretty impressive. His work has touched countless viewers, and his presence on screen is, you know, just something special. He has, in fact, become a household name for his roles.

His big break, the one that really put him on the map, was playing the private investigator Thomas Magnum in the popular 1980s detective series, *Magnum, P.I.* That show, frankly, became a cultural touchstone of its time. It earned him a Golden Globe and an Emmy, which are, as a matter of fact, very significant awards in the entertainment world. This role solidified his place as a leading man, and it's something people still talk about today.

Beyond his television success, Selleck has also made a notable mark in films. He played the bachelor architect Peter Mitchell in the much-loved comedy *Three Men and a Baby* from 1987, and then again in its sequel, *Three Men and a Little Lady*, which came out in 1990. These movies showed a different side to his acting, proving his versatility and ability to connect with audiences in a comedic setting. He's appeared in more than 50 other films and television productions, which is quite a lot, actually, showcasing a rather extensive body of work.

Iconic Roles: Thomas Magnum and Peter Mitchell

When you talk about Tom Selleck's career, two roles stand out as truly iconic, shaping his public image and cementing his place in television and film history. The first, and arguably the most famous, is his portrayal of Thomas Magnum in *Magnum, P.I.* This detective series, set in the beautiful landscapes of Hawaii, captivated audiences throughout the 1980s. Magnum was a cool, charming, and clever private investigator, and Selleck brought a unique blend of wit and rugged appeal to the character. It was, you know, a perfect fit for him.

The show's success was immense, and it turned Tom Selleck into a bona fide star, recognized globally. His performance as Magnum was so compelling that it earned him both a Golden Globe and an Emmy, which are, like, major achievements in acting. The character's signature look, including his mustache and Hawaiian shirts, became instantly recognizable, and honestly, it's still a look that brings back a lot of nostalgia for many. He really made that role his own, didn't he?

Then there's the beloved character of Peter Mitchell from the hit film *Three Men and a Baby* and its follow-up, *Three Men and a Little Lady*. In these movies, Selleck played a bachelor architect who, along with two friends, suddenly finds himself responsible for a baby left on their doorstep. This role showcased his comedic timing and his ability to play a more vulnerable, yet still charming, character. It was a very different kind of part from Magnum, and yet, he pulled it off beautifully, showing his range as an actor. You know, it's pretty impressive to switch gears like that.

Who is Peter Mitchell in Three Men and a Baby?

Peter Mitchell is a character played by Tom Selleck in the popular 1987 film *Three Men and a Baby* and its 1990 sequel, *Three Men and a Little Lady*. Peter is an architect who lives with his two bachelor friends, Michael and Jack. Their lives take an unexpected turn when a baby girl named Mary is left on their doorstep, forcing the three men to learn how to care for her. It's a charming role that showcased Selleck's comedic talents, and honestly, it's a film that many people still love. He was, you know, quite good in it.
